CONTACT DETAILS OF SHRI MAHAVIRJI FINLEASE PRIVATE LIMITED

110001
INDIA
E-985,100 FEET ROAD, BABARPUR, SHAHDARA, NEW DELHI DELHI INDIA 110001
itreturnsonline@srsparivar.com

Details Updated by Companies